Output 151d60bf417355a77df75eeced2485751a8a4808aeea30f6ddbb345675c371b0:1

value
70763
script pubkey
OP_0 OP_PUSHBYTES_20 e127bcbdcbf4d766ddc084edbca1997fc40f4e13
address
bc1quynme0wt7ntkdhwqsnkmegve0lzq7nsn7mc7tm
transaction
151d60bf417355a77df75eeced2485751a8a4808aeea30f6ddbb345675c371b0
confirmations
98430
spent
true